Team Anna again target Himachal political parties and urged Himachal Pradesh voters to boycott both Congress and BJP in the forthcoming state Assembly elections. Team Anna alleged that both the parties are hand-in-gloves with each other in fleecing the innocent people of this hill state and take turns to do it.

Arvind Kejriwal told media that their team would also hold awareness campaigns in the state to eradicate the corruption and the nexus between politicians and corporates before the state assembly elections later this year. Kejriwal refrain from endorsing any political outfit said that the leaders having good public image should come out from the public.

Team Anna members Arvind Kejriwal, Gopal Roy, Manish Shshodia and Sanjay Singh were in Kangra to address a state level meet on their campaign on India Against Corruption.

Kejriwal also invited the people of Himachal Pradesh to participate in their campaign beginning July 25 in New Delhi for demanding a strong Lokpal bill. Team Anna blamed Prime Minister Manmohan Singh for the auction of 155 coal blocks, which they said has resulted in the loss of over Rs two lakh crores as pointed out by the Comptroller and Auditor General of India in its report. Team Anna members are demanding an impartial probe by retired Supreme Court judges against into allegations of corruption and criminal acts against 39 MPs and 15 ministers.
